摘 要:针对杜229断块南部兴V组出水问题,精细统层对比,深化油藏地质研究;结合油井生产动态,开展全过程水性跟踪和示踪剂监测试验.其结果不仅确定了边水水侵部位、层位及方向,而且对水侵速度、能量大小及涉及程度有了全新的认识.在此基础上制定并实施了科学有序的堵水、堵排结合治水、综合治水方案,在已实施的26井次堵水措施中,成功率100%,累计增油6.1×104t,确保了全块持续高产、稳产.其工作思路和方法,不仅对开发同类型油藏有现实意义,而且对基础油藏的开发也有借鉴意义.In accordance with the problem of water producing in Xing-V formation in the south of block Du229, fine correlation of formations is conducted, and reservoir geology is studied deeply. Combining with production performance, full-course tracing of water property and tracer monitoring are carried out. Not only are the location, horizon and direction of edge water invasion adequately settled, but also a new understanding is obtained about water invasion velocity, energy and extent. On this basis, a comprehensive plan of water blocking, draining, or both of them following scientific procedures is made and implemented. After applying to water plugging for 26 well times, its success ratio is 100 % , cumulative oil increment is 6. 1 ×104t, thus ensuring continuing stable high production in the whole block. This thought and method have practical significance for developing similar reservoirs, and are reference to basic reservoir development.
